#efb07c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#efb07c is composed of 93.7% red, 69%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.4% magenta, 48.1%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 27.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 71.2%. #efb07c color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ff8 with #df6100.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

Shades and Tints of #efb07c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090501 is the darkest color, while #fefaf6 is the lightest one.
